Nate Diaz teammate to face fellow UFC vet on MVP ‘Rousey vs. Carano’ card

Chris Avila has stayed active in boxing in recent years. | Esther Lin/Fanmio


Most Valuable Promotions has finalized its first-ever mixed martial arts card with a matchup of two UFC veterans.

Chris Avila will lock horns with Brandon Jenkins in a 165-pound catchweight bout at the May 16 event, which takes place at the Intuit Dome in Los Angeles. MVP confirmed the booking on Saturday. Avila had previously been slated for the event but did not have an opponent when the card was initially announced.

Well-Traveled Veterans

A training partner of Nate Diaz, Avila fought twice for the UFC in 2016, dropping decisons to Artem Lobov and Enrique Barzola. The 33-year-old Cesar Gracie Fight team represenetative has compiled an 8-9 record over the course of his professional tenure, also competing for organizations such as Bellator and Combate Americas. His last pro MMA appearance came in 2021, but he has remained active in professional boxing since then.

Jenkins, meanwhile, went 0-2 during a brief UFC stint from 2021 to 2022, suffering TKO losses to both Zhu Rong and Drakkar Klose. The 34-year-old known as “The Highlight Reel” last fought in October 2025 and has competed for promotions such as Bellator MMA Professional Fighters League and Legacy Fighting Alliance while putting together a 17-12 mark.
